Rainham (Essex) station prioritizes passenger comfort with a number of useful facilities. Ticketing is seamless with electronic ticket machines and the added convenience of collecting pre-purchased tickets. The ticket office operates on weekdays from 06:15 to 09:50—ideal for early morning travelers. Accessibility is a notable feature; the station proudly offers step-free access across its premises. There are five accessible parking spaces to ensure easy access for those with mobility challenges. Induction loops and accessible toilets located on Platform 2 cater to the needs of all travelers.
Though lacking a waiting room or onsite shops, Platform 2 features refreshment facilities for that caffeine kick pre-journey, and free public Wi-Fi keeps you connected on the go. While there's no ATM machine, secure bicycle storage with CCTV protection is available for cyclists. Safety is prioritized with CCTV monitoring throughout the site.

Upon entering Fratton Train Station, passengers can find a range of facilities to make their journey as smooth as possible. The station's ticket office is open from early morning until late evening, making it easy to buy or collect pre-booked tickets. For those traveling with a Disabled Persons Railcard or requiring accessible services, all the ticket machines are equipped to accommodate these needs.
Travelers will appreciate the clear signage and departure screens, and with staff help available throughout the week until late at night, assistance is always within reach. Despite the lack of a formal waiting room, there’s ample seating available. While there are no luggage storage facilities, the station is equipped with CCTV for added security.
If you’re feeling peckish before your journey, Fratton Station has refreshment facilities offering a variety of food and drink options. Although there's no ATM onsite, public Wi-Fi is available, allowing you to stay connected as you wait for your train. Bicycle enthusiasts can make use of the sheltered storage on Platform 1, with plenty of space for bikes.
Fratton is a step-free category A station, ensuring ease of movement for all travelers. Accessible ticket machines, toilets, and a dedicated helpline are in place to support those with additional needs. While the car park has limited accessible spaces, alternative parking arrangements can be made if you’re traveling to the station by car.
Fratton Train Station is well-linked to various modes of onward transport. For instance, replacement rail services operate from Goldsmith Avenue, just a short walk across the footbridge from the station. Additionally, a taxi rank is located directly outside the main entrance, ensuring smooth onward travel in private hire cars.
Several local buses operate from nearby stops, providing convenient connections to various parts of Portsmouth.
